Aici gasiti principalele functii pentru SimpleXML.
- SimpleXML are relativ putine functii predefinite, deoarece se apeleaza mult la functiile pentru Array si String (siruri).
- simplexml_load_file("fisier.xml") - Incarca in memorie, ca obiect, datele din "fisier.xml"
- simplexml_load_string("sir_xml") - Incarca in memorie, ca obiect, datele din sirul "sir_xml"
- simplexml_import_dom("dom_node") - Transforma (preia) un obiect DOM (sau Nod dintr-un obiect DOM) in obiect SimpleXML
- addChild("nume", "continut") - Adauga un element copil in cel curent (la sfarsit daca are si altele) cu numele "nume" si continutul text "continut" (acesta e optional).
- addAttribute("nume", "valoare") - Adauga un atribut intr-un element (la sfarsit daca are si altele) cu numele "nume" si valoarea "valoare".
- children() - Preia intr-o matrice toti copii dintr-un nod (element).
- attributes() - Preia intr-o matrice toate atributele dintr-un element.
- count() - Returneaza numarul de copii dintr-un element.
- getName() - Returneaza numele unui element (Folosit adesea cand se parcurge o matrice cu mai multe elemente).
- asXML("fisier.xml") - Transforma datele obiectului SimpleXML intr-un sir, iar daca parametrul "fisier.xml" e specificat (e optional) scrie sirul in acel fisier.
-
Lista completa cu functiile SimpleXML o gasiti la pagina Functii SimpleXML
Un Test simplu in fiecare zi
HTML
CSS
JavaScript
PHP-MySQL
Engleza
Spaniola
Ce tag se foloseste pentru a adauga liste in elemente <ul> si <ol>?
<dt> <dd> <li><ul>
<li>http://coursesweb.net/html/</li>
<li>http://www.marplo.net/html/</li>
</ul>
Care valoare a proprietatii "display" seteaza elementul ca tip bloc si afiseaza un punct in fata?
block list-item inline-block.some_class {
display: list-item;
}
Care instructiune JavaScript transforma un obiect in sir JSON.
JSON.parse() JSON.stringify eval()var obj = {
"courses": ["php", "javascript", "ajax"]
};
var jsonstr = JSON.stringify(obj);
alert(jsonstr); // {"courses":["php","javascript","ajax"]}
Indicati clasa PHP folosita pentru a lucra cu elemente HTML si XML in PHP.
stdClass PDO DOMDocument$strhtml = '<body><div id="dv1">CoursesWeb.net</div></body>';
$dochtml = new DOMDocument();
$dochtml->loadHTML($strhtml);
$elm = $dochtml->getElementById("dv1");
echo $elm->nodeValue; // CoursesWeb.net
Indicati forma de Prezent Continuu a verbului "to live" (a trai /a locui)
lived living liveingI`m living here.
- Traiesc /Locuiesc aici.
Care este forma de Gerunziu (sau Participiu Prezent) a verbului "vivir" (a trai /a locui)?
viviĆ³ vivido viviendoEstoy viviendo aquĆ.
- Traiesc /Locuiesc aici.